This Proto-Finnic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-Finnic[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Proto-Finno-Ugric *kuľma.

Noun[edit]

*kulma

  1. eyebrow
  2. corner of the eye

Inflection[edit]

Descendants[edit]

  • Estonian: kulm
  • Finnish: kulma
  • Ingrian: kulma
  • Karelian: kulma
  • Livonian: gūlma
  • Livvi: kulmu
  • Ludian: kulm
  • Veps: kulm
  • Võro: kulm
  • Votic: kulmõ, (Kattila, Mati, Pummala) kulmo
  • Proto-Samic: *kulmē
